What Are "Would You Rather Questions For Adult Learners" and Why Are They Awesome?

So, what exactly are "Would You Rather Questions For Adult Learners"? Think of them as mini-thought experiments. You're presented with two distinct, often tricky, choices. The catch? You *have* to pick one! This forces you to weigh the pros and cons, consider your values, and sometimes even embrace the absurd. They've become super popular because they offer a low-stakes way to engage with complex ideas and spark interesting conversations. In a classroom or a workshop, they can break the ice, get people talking, and make learning feel less like a chore and more like an adventure.

Why are they so effective? Well, several reasons! For starters, they tap into our natural curiosity. We all love a good dilemma! They're also great for:

  • Stimulating critical thinking skills
  • Encouraging empathy by understanding others' choices
  • Promoting creative problem-solving
  • Boosting communication and active listening
  • Making abstract concepts more relatable and memorable

The importance of these questions lies in their ability to create a shared experience and foster a deeper understanding through active participation. They’re versatile too. You can use them for:

  1. Icebreakers at the start of a session.
  2. Discussion prompts to explore a topic from different angles.
  3. Team-building activities to encourage collaboration.
  4. Personal reflection exercises to understand your own preferences.
